How masonry takeoff works
- Open your drawings. Drag the architectural and structural sheets into the browser. Nothing uploads, nothing installs.
- Set the scale. Click a known dimension and type its length, or pick a standard scale. Every measurement then reads in real feet.
- Measure and count. Trace wall areas by type and the lintels, joints, and reinforcing, and count openings. Detect Runs groups wall line-work to give you a head start.
- Export. Send wall areas and linear items to Excel or CSV, then apply your units per square foot for block and brick counts.

Can I take off block and brick wall areas?
Yes. Measure CMU, block, and brick veneer wall areas in square feet to scale, by wall type, with running subtotals as you go.
Can I get block and brick unit counts?
Measure the wall area to scale, then apply your units per square foot to get block or brick counts for your estimate. The area exports to Excel, where your unit factor turns it into quantities.
